摘要:
目的:探讨股骨头坏死中医证型与血液学指标的关系。方法:选取股骨头坏死患者74例,男45例,女29例。年龄13~75岁,中位数57.5岁。根据自拟分型标准,将74例患者分为3型,气滞血瘀型20例(Ⅰ组),肾虚血瘀型26例(Ⅱ组),痰瘀蕴结型28例(Ⅲ组)。患者入院后次日清晨空腹抽取肘静脉血,测定血液流变学指标及血脂指标,包括全血黏度、血浆黏度、血细胞比容、红细胞沉降率、红细胞聚集指数、红细胞变形指数、血沉方程K值、血液屈服应力、卡松黏度、红细胞电泳时间、全血高切还原黏度、全血中切还原黏度、全血低切还原黏度、刚性指数、总胆固醇、甘油三酯、载脂蛋白A、载脂蛋白B、高密度脂蛋白、低密度脂蛋白。结果:①血液流变学指标。3组患者全血高切黏度(200/s)比较,差异有统计学意义(F=7.654,P=0.001),Ⅱ组[(4.72±1.10)mPa·s]高于Ⅰ组[(3.96±0.61)mPa·s]和Ⅲ组[(3.83±0.83)mPa·s](P=0.014; P=0.005),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.901); 3组患者全血中切黏度(30/s)比较,差异有统计学意义(F=6.913,P=0.002),Ⅱ组[(5.68±1.33)mPa·s]高于Ⅰ组[(4.77±0.74)mPa·s]和Ⅲ组[(4.68±0.98)mPa·s](P=0.016; P=0.009),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.977); 3组患者全血低切黏度(3/s)比较,差异有统计学意义(F=7.046,P=0.002),Ⅱ组[(11.43±2.64)mPa·s]高于Ⅰ组[(9.61±1.50)mPa·s]和Ⅲ组[(9.39±2.02)mPa·s](P=0.016; P=0.008),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.959); 3组患者红细胞聚集指数比较,差异有统计学意义(F=8.464,P=0.001),Ⅱ组(7.88±1.83)高于Ⅰ组(6.74±1.13)和Ⅲ组(6.27±1.27)(P=0.016; P=0.009),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.977); 3组患者红细胞变形指数比较,差异有统计学意义(F=18.514,P=0.000),Ⅱ组(0.93±0.09)高于Ⅰ组(0.82±0.09)和Ⅲ组(0.76±0.13)(P=0.000; P=0.000),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.102); 3组患者红细胞电泳时间比较,差异有统计学意义(F=7.760,P=0.001),Ⅱ组[(17.70±4.12)s]高于Ⅰ组[(14.84±2.27)s]和Ⅲ组[(14.08±3.59)s](P=0.014; P=0.004),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.760); 3组患者全血高切还原黏度比较,差异有统计学意义(F=15.685,P=0.000),Ⅱ组(5.61±1.35)高于Ⅰ组(4.35±0.91)和Ⅲ组(3.88±1.13)(P=0.001; P=0.000),Ⅰ组高于Ⅲ组(P=0.000); 3组患者全血中切还原黏度比较,差异有统计学意义(F=6.573,P=0.002),Ⅱ组(7.27±1.61)高于Ⅰ组(5.75±1.09)和Ⅲ组(5.61±2.35)(P=0.001; P=0.004),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.802); 3组患者全血低切还原黏度比较,差异有统计学意义(F=19.552,P=0.000),Ⅱ组(17.30±3.00)高于Ⅰ组(14.13±2.23)和Ⅲ组(12.71±2.81)(P=0.000; P=0.000),Ⅰ组与Ⅲ组比较,差异无统计学意义(P=0.066); 其余各项血液流变学指标组间比较,差异均无统计学意义。②血脂指标。3组患者总胆固醇比较,差异有统计学意义(F=5.235,P=0.008),Ⅲ组[(5.42±0.89)mmol·L-1]高于Ⅰ组[(4.56±0.77)mmol·L-1]和Ⅱ组[(4.97±1.03)mmol·L-1](P=0.001; P=0.022),Ⅱ组与Ⅰ组比较,差异无统计学意义(P=0.145); 3组患者甘油三酯比较,差异有统计学意义(F=3.123,P=0.050),Ⅲ组[(2.03±0.81)mmol·L-1]高于Ⅰ组[(1.51±0.74)mmol·L-1]和Ⅱ组[(1.64±0.74)mmol·L-1](P=0.018; P=0.032),Ⅱ组高于Ⅰ组(P=0.000); 3组患者载脂蛋白A比较,差异有统计学意义(F=3.733,P=0.029),Ⅲ组[(0.87±0.12)g·L-1]低于Ⅰ组[(0.98±0.18)g·L-1]和Ⅱ组[(0.96±0.14)g·L-1](P=0.019; P=0.022),Ⅱ组与Ⅰ组比较,差异无统计学意义(P=0.634); 3组患者载脂蛋白B比较,差异有统计学意义(F=4.336,P=0.017),Ⅲ组[(1.14±0.41)g·L-1]高于Ⅰ组[(0.92±0.16)g·L-1]和Ⅱ组[(0.90±0.30)g·L-1](P=0.048; P=0.039),Ⅱ组与Ⅰ组比较,差异无统计学意义(P=1.000); 3组患者高密度脂蛋白比较,差异有统计学意义(F=3.207,P=0.046),Ⅲ组[(0.90±0.17)mmol·L-1]低于Ⅰ组[(1.05±0.32)mmol·L-1]和Ⅱ组[(1.02±0.19)mmol·L-1](P=0.037; P=0.048),Ⅱ组与Ⅰ组比较,差异无统计学意义(P=0.975); 3组患者低密度脂蛋白[(2.78±0.46)mmol·L-1,(2.93±0.88)mmol·L-1,(3.27±0.96)mmol·L-1]比较,差异无统计学意义(F=2.302,P=0.107)。结论:肾虚血瘀型股骨头坏死患者以血液流变学指标异常升高为特点,痰瘀蕴结型股骨头坏死患者以血脂指标异常改变为特点。
Abstract:
Objective:To explore the relationship between TCM syndromes of osteonecrosis of femoral head(ONFH)and hematological indexes.Methods:Seventy-four patients with ONFH were selected,male 45 cases,while femal 29 cases,ranging in age from 13 to 75 years with a median of 57.5 years.According to the self-designed classification criteria,all the patients were divided into 3 types as 20 cases with QI STAGNATION BLOOD STASIS type(groupⅠ),26 cases with KIDNEY DEFICIENCY BLOOD STASIS type(groupⅡ)and 28 cases with PHLEGM STAGNATION type(groupⅢ).The blood was drawn from the fasting patient's ulnar vein in the following morning after hospital admission,and such hemorheology indexes and serum lipid indexes were measured as blood viscosity,plasma viscosity(ηp),hematocrit(HCT),erythrocyte sedimentation rate(ESR),red blood cell aggregation index(Arbe),red blood cell deformation index(TK),sedimentation equation K value(K),blood yield stress(γc),casson viscosity(ηc),red blood cell electrophoresis time(EPT),high shear whole blood reduced viscosity(HRV),medium shear whole blood reduced viscosity(MRV),low shear whole blood reduced viscosity(LRV),red blood cell rigidity index(IR),cholesterol total(CHOL),triglyceride(TG),apolipoprotein A(ApoA),apolipoprotein B(ApoB),high density lipoprotein(HDL)and low density lipoprotein(LDL).Results:①Hemorheology indexes:there was statistical difference in high shear whole blood viscosity(HV)(200/s)among the 3 groups(F=7.654,P=0.001),HV of groupⅡ((4.72±1.10)mPa·s)was higher than that of groupⅠ((3.96±0.61)mPa·s)and groupⅢ((3.83±0.83)mPa·s)respectively(P=0.014; P=0.005),while there was no statistical difference between groupⅠand groupⅢ(P=0.901).There was statistical difference in medium shear whole blood viscosity(MV)(30/s)among the 3 groups(F=6.913,P=0.002),MV of groupⅡ((5.68±1.33)mPa·s)was higher than that of groupⅠ((4.77±0.74)mPa·s)and groupⅢ((4.68±0.98)mPa·s)respectively(P=0.016; P=0.009),while there was no statistical difference between groupⅠand groupⅢ(P=0.977).There was statistical difference in low shear whole blood viscosity(LV)(3/s)among the 3 groups(F=7.046,P=0.002),LV of groupⅡ((11.43±2.64)mPa·s)was higher than that of groupⅠ((9.61±1.50)mPa·s)and groupⅢ((9.39±2.02)mPa·s)respectively(P=0.016; P=0.008),while there was no statistical difference between groupⅠand groupⅢ(P=0.959).There was statistical difference in Arbe among the 3 groups(F=8.464,P=0.001),Arbe of groupⅡ(7.88±1.83)was higher than that of groupⅠ(6.74±1.13)and groupⅢ(6.27±1.27)respectively(P=0.016; P=0.009),while there was no statistical difference between groupⅠand groupⅢ(P=0.977).There was statistical difference in TK among the 3 groups(F=18.514,P=0.000),TK of groupⅡ(0.93±0.09)was higher than that of groupⅠ(0.82±0.09)and groupⅢ(0.76±0.13)respectively(P=0.000; P=0.000),while there was no statistical difference between groupⅠand groupⅢ(P=0.102).There was statistical difference in EPT among the 3 groups(F=7.760,P=0.001),EPT of groupⅡ((17.70±4.12)s)was higher than that of groupⅠ((14.84±2.27)s)and groupⅢ((14.08±3.59)s)respectively(P=0.014; P=0.004),while there was no statistical difference between groupⅠand groupⅢ(P=0.760).There was statistical difference in HRV among the 3 groups(F=15.685,P=0.000),HRV of groupⅡ(5.61±1.35)was higher than that of groupⅠ(4.35±0.91)and groupⅢ(3.88±1.13)respectively(P=0.001; P=0.000),and HRV of groupⅠwas higher than that of groupⅢ(P=0.000).There was statistical difference in MRV among the 3 groups(F=6.573,P=0.002),MRV of groupⅡ(7.27±1.61)was higher than that of groupⅠ(5.75±1.09)and groupⅢ(5.61±2.35)respectively(P=0.001; P=0.004),while there was no statistical difference between groupⅠand groupⅢ(P=0.802).There was statistical difference in LRV among the 3 groups(F=19.552,P=0.000),LRV of groupⅡ(17.30±3.00)was higher than that of groupⅠ(14.13±2.23)and groupⅢ(12.71±2.81)respectively(P=0.000; P=0.000),while there was no statistical difference between groupⅠand groupⅢ(P=0.066).There was no statistical difference in the other hemorheology indexes among the 3 groups respectively.②Serum lipid indexes:there was statistical difference in CHOL among the 3 groups(F=5.235,P=0.008),CHOL of groupⅢ((5.42±0.89)mmol/L)was higher than that of groupⅠ((4.56±0.77)mmol/L)and groupⅡ((4.97±1.03)mmol/L)respectively(P=0.001; P=0.022),while there was no statistical difference between groupⅡand groupⅠ(P=0.145).There was statistical difference in TG among the 3 groups(F=3.123,P=0.050),TG of groupⅢ((2.03±0.81)mmol/L)was higher than that of groupⅠ((1.51±0.74)mmol/L)and groupⅡ((1.64±0.74)mmol/L)respectively(P=0.018; P=0.032),and TG of groupⅡ was higher than that of groupⅠ(P=0.000).There was statistical difference in ApoA among the 3 groups(F=3.733,P=0.029),ApoA of groupⅢ((0.87±0.12)g/L)was lower than that of groupⅠ((0.98±0.18)g/L)and groupⅡ((0.96±0.14)g/L)respectively(P=0.019; P=0.022),while there was no statistical difference between groupⅡand groupⅠ(P=0.634).There was statistical difference in ApoB among the 3 groups(F=4.336,P=0.017),ApoB of groupⅢ((1.14±0.41)g/L)was higher than that of groupⅠ((0.92±0.16)g/L)and groupⅡ((0.90±0.30)g/L)respectively(P=0.048; P=0.039),while there was no statistical difference between groupⅡand groupⅠ(P=1.000).There was statistical difference in HDL among the 3 groups(F=3.207,P=0.046),HDL of groupⅢ((0.90±0.17)mmol/L)was lower than that of groupⅠ((1.05±0.32)mmol/L)and groupⅡ((1.02±0.19)mmol/L)respectively(P=0.037; P=0.048),while there was no statistical difference between groupⅡand groupⅠ(P=0.975).There was no statistical difference in LDL among the 3 groups((2.78±0.46)mmol/L,(2.93±0.88)mmol/L,(3.27±0.96)mmol/L))(F=2.302,P=0.107).Conclusion:ONFH patients with KIDNEY DEFICIENCY BLOOD STASIS type is characterized by abnormal increase of hemorheology indexes,while ONFH patients with PHLEGM STAGNATION type is characterized by abnormality of serum lipid indexes.
